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A FOR HAL EXAM:- Educational Qualification : You must have be completed Bachelor’s degree from a recognized university . The eligible stream are Mechanical , chemical, computer science, civil, electronics & telecommunications, metallurgy, ceramics, instrumentations or electrical. You should be score at least 65% (50 % for SC / ST). Those who have MCA degree are also eligible provided the minimum aggregate marks is 65 % ( 50% for SC / ST candidates). Your age should not be crossed 30 years. There is relaxation of 5 yrs. for SC / ST, 3 yrs for OBC & 10 yrs for physically handicapped candidates. Re: Am I eligible for HAL exam if I scored 65% in B.Tech and 58% in one semester? of course you are eligible to attend hal exam. Eligibility: • graduate in mechanical/ electronics/ electrical/ production/computer science/ metallurgy/ aeronautic branches of engineering from any recognized institution/university. • general/ obc candidates should have secured 65% marks and sc/st candidates should have secured a minimum of 55% marks. In the aggregate (average of marks scored for all the semesters/ years) or corresponding cgpa ratings / gradations in their engineering degree examinations. • engineering graduates in the aeronautical branch with minimum aggregate 60% marks (for general/obc) and 50% for sc/st would be eligible to apply. • applications should be submitted strictly 'online' by logging to hal website after recruitment notification.
